The Ryusoulgers are watching a breaking news report about Japanese Prime Minister Karino Mioko being hospitalized for unknown reasons. Papa Naohisa says she’s really pretty and was formerly a fortune teller. Melt says he read a tabloid article about PM Karino going out with an older man.

Ui calls everyone’s attention to an online post showing photos of a woman who appears to be the prime minister in different eras and different countries around the world. The rumors are the prime minister is actually immortal. Papa Naohisa wishes he could be immortal.

At the hospital, Towa and Bamba meet the prime minister in her room. Bamba says she is a former member of the Ryusoul tribe.

PM Karino gets up from bed and hugs Bamba-chan. Towa is confused.

On the other side of town, Kureon brings Waizuru to their new hideout in an underground parking garage. But Waizuru looks for a funicular and a disco ball for dancing. Just then, a Minosaur appears and zaps Kureon which forces him to say what he is really thinking out loud.

Back at the hospital, PM Karino explains she left the village 300 years ago and started traveling the world. When she returned to Japan, she began fortune telling and began advising a politician who encouraged her to enter politics.

PM Karino says she left the village because she wanted a normal life. But now she’s had 300 years of a normal life and it’s gotten boring. She acknowledges maybe the grass really is greener on the other side and you just want what you don’t have.

Bamba asks what she wants from them. She mentions how she wasn’t chosen to become a Ryusoulger and admits the Minosaur was born from her and asks them to defeat it only after it has become complete and embiggened.

Towa tries to point out the obvious, but PM Karino beats him to it and says it’s fine if she dies. She offers to tell them about their Master if they do as she asks.

Towa and Bamba leave. Bamba says they’ll just have to continue as they normally have in defeating a Minosaur.

Just then, the Minosaur attacks a nearby couple who begin to be brutally honest with each other.

Towa can’t help but think about PM Karino and hesitates a little before he and Bamba morph. They battle the Minosaur, but it can predict their attacks. Towa tells Bamba they have to wait for the Minosaur to be complete. The further hesitation allows the Minosaur to attack and force them to demorph.

The Minosaur leaves. Bamba tells Towa to stop with the hesitation and that they can find out about their Master after they defeat the Minosaur.

Back at the hospital, PM Karino is happy to see her life energy continuing to fly away. Just then, she sense someone else is in the room. And that someone ends up being Gaisorg who offers to kill her if she wants.

PM Karino says she and Gaisorg are the same, wandering around with no place to go. She says he probably doesn’t remember his days as a hero and that he’ll probably birth a Minosaur too.

PM Karino visits an older man who is also in the hospital and dying. She gives him some flowers and apologizes she could not grow old with him.

After telling the others about the prime minister, Bamba finds PM Karino with the man and now understands the Minosaur was birthed from the pain of not being able to grow old with a loved one.

Downtown, the Minosaur has just leveled an entire skyscraper and killed everyone inside. Koh, Melt, Asuna and Towa arrive and morph. They are unable to counter the Minosaur’s power.

Asuna gets hit with the Minosaur’s truth beam and she begins to criticize Melt. Melt takes it very personally.

Back at the hospital, PM Karino explains to Bamba her feeling of being different. But now she has decided she can die with the person she loves for once. Bamba says she can’t just run away from her problems by dying. He says it’s absurd for her as a prime minister who should be trying to protect the country instead of allowing the Minosaur to grow and murder everyone.

She says it doesn’t matter if she’s prime minister or not. But Bamba reminds her she was born into the Ryusoul tribe and she must play the game with the cards that’ve been dealt to her. And suicide is never the answer.

Meanwhile, Koh summons Tyramigo and DimeVolcano, They get shot with the Minosaur’s beam and they both become critical of each other. Tyramigo says DimeVolcano’s riddles are horrible. DimeVolcano says he really likes Tyramigo though.

DimeVolcano says Tyramigo can answer his questions any way he likes. He only asks questions and riddles because he likes to talk with others. Tyramigo admits that he actually doesn’t hate DimeVolcano at all. DimeVolcano cries tears of joy.

Towa points out it’s nice to be honest with your true feelings once in a while.

Koh has the two Kishiryu combine into KishiryuOh DimeVolcano.

Bamba arrives and tells them the Minosaur is afraid of its bandages catching fire. Asuna uses MawariSoul and whips up a gas tank to help Koh burn the Minosaur. Asuna’s luck kicks in and it allows them to attack without the Minosaur predicting it.

Koh uses MeraMeraSoul and delivers a finisher at the Minosaur.

Bamba realizes the Minosaur has been trying to say “I wanna die.”

PM Karino watches as her life energy returns to her. She cries as she look as her loved one and remembers Bamba telling her not to run away by dying. She removes her necklace and looks at it before she disappears from the room.

Towa and Bamba hurry to the hospital, but they’re too late. PM Karino has escaped and Japan no longer has a prime minister.

Back home, Melt and Asuna seem to still be sulking about what happened between them earlier. Koh tries to cheer them up and get them to make up. But Asuna has something to say. She tells Melt how grateful she is for him being able to come up with plans to defeat the Minosaurs. She adds that there are just some things that are too embarrassing to say out loud.

The news of the prime minister’s disappearance spreads across Japan.

Towa is on a rooftop ready to find PM Karino. But Bamba stops him and says they’ve been played all along.

Bamba says their Master abandoned them, but that he must have had a reason. They wonder if they’ll ever be able to see their Master again.

Episode Thoughts

Wow! That was a very fascinating episode. Obviously, this was another episode focused on a character wanting to die. But not only that, they essentially touched on the issue of assisted suicide and euthanasia, didn’t they? Though she wasn’t necessarily physically ill. But still, she was certainly looking for Towa and Bamba to help her die with her loved one.

It really has been fascinating to watch Ryusoulger develop. They’ve been a little bit all over the place with some nice highs and some VERY low lows. But it appears they’re getting to a good rhythm now. I liked this episode for many reasons.

First, they tackled the suicide aspect (is this now officially a running theme for this season?) maybe the best so far of their attempts this season. You can understand where PM Karino is coming from when she expresses how hard it is for her to live all these years and watch her loved ones die. It’s not a new concept when it comes to immortal characters and the like. But it is used well here. The way it unfolded in the beginning with the gang at Chez Tatsui reading the news reports and the viral posts about the prime minister being immortal and dating an old man, you didn’t really know where everything was going after that. But it eventually made perfect sense.

Second, this was a particularly strong psuedo-Bamba focus. This might be the best episode for his character so far. He really shined this episode, most especially in his conversation with PM Karino. He was strong and decisive, but also compassionate.

And next, it’s the overall message the episode seemed to convey. As Bamba basically explained, even if things get hard, you shouldn’t run away from those problems by just dying. Essentially, killing yourself is not a solution to hardship you might be feeling now.

In conjunction with that, the episode was also trying to convey that you should be open and honest. And letting others know how you really feel is a very good thing. It can relieve and avoid conflict and it can help you with your personal mental health as well. Being comfortable with other people and knowing you can say what you truly feel is a good thing.

Melt was hurt by Asuna’s telling him how she really felt. But in the end, they both realize it’s necessary to be truthful with one another. And also it isn’t always easy to do.

Tyramigo and DimeVolcano telling each other their true feelings was very fun and cute. And it was a good balance to the rest of the episode.

But back to PM Karino, she may not have gone through with wanting to kill herself. But she still ran away so I will assume this is definitely not a closed case just yet. She’s just thrown Japan in chaos, of course. lol

I totally forgot the previews for this episode and was surprised she was a member of the Ryusoul tribe. So very interesting for her and Bamba to know each other. But how does she know Gaisorg? And where is going now that she’s run away from her responsibilities. I think we’ll be seeing more of her.

Elsewhere, I always think it’s crazy when the MOTW just randomly levels buildings. Like, how many people must have logically died in those buildings?! So insane to point at those details in this KIDS show! lol

Anyway, overall I really enjoyed this episode. A really well written and well executed episode that hit all the right notes. Definitely a first for Ryusoulger. And I hope it continues.
